  • Collection summary Primarily includes visual materials relating to the CAP efforts to address social and political inequalities on Chicago's South Side and in the south suburbs. Includes photographs of hearings and meetings on taxation, crosstown expressway relocation, and red-lining of neighborhoods. Videotape is labeled as follows: Bill Moyer's Journal: This neighborhood is obsolete.

  • Location of Other Archival Materials Note Related materials at Chicago History Museum, Research Center, include the Citizens Action Program records; the Citizens Action Program records collected by Father Dubi; the Citizens Action Program records collected by Paul Booth; the South Side Anti-Crosstown Coalition (Chicago, Ill.) records; and other social action manuscript collections. The University of Illinois at Chicago, Library Special Collections Dept. also holds a collection of Citizens Action Program records.
